Jhené Aiko has received a new Recording Industry Association of America (RIAA) certification. “When We Love,” lifted from her 2017 album, Trip, has been certified gold with 500,000 equivalent units sold. Formed during the pandemic’s isolation, Pennsylvanian rabble rousers Boozewa return to disrupt your week with a new song. Featuring Jessica Baker (bass, hollering) and Mike Cummings (drums, hollering) of Backwoods Payback, Boozewa are a heavy swig of good-times grunge with a sludgy hangover.
